24c08.h

来自「利用MSP430FE427单片机」· C头文件 代码 · 共 38 行

H
38
字号
#ifndef __24C08_H__
#define __24C08_H__

#define SCL   BIT0 
#define SDA   BIT1     

#define SCL_IN P2DIR &= ~SCL 
#define SCL_OUT P2DIR |= SCL

#define SCL_L P2OUT &= ~SCL
#define SCL_H P2OUT |= SCL

#define SDA_IN P2DIR &= ~SDA
#define SDA_OUT P2DIR |= SDA

#define SDA_L P2OUT &= ~SDA
#define SDA_H P2OUT |= SDA

#define SDA_BIT P2IN & SDA

#define WR24C04 0xA0
#define RD24C04 0xA1

#define uchar unsigned char
#define uint unsigned int 
#define ulnt unsigned long int 
#define Num 64

void start();
void stop();
void write(uchar j);
uchar read();
uchar testack();
void Write_Data(uchar *wdata,uint waddr,uchar len);
uchar Read_Data(uchar *rdata,uint raddr,uint len);

#endif

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?